Heat pumps - ambient heat captured by technology and climate in 2007

  • Value: 1,211.88 GWh
  • Change vs 2006: +181.623 GWh (+17.63 %)
  • Position in history: below the 21-year average (average — 3,065.26 GWh)
  • Series maximum — 7,159.88 GWh in 2024
  • Series minimum — 0 GWh in 2004 (3 years ago)
  • Value date: 1 January 2007
  • Source: Eurostat
